Water Temperature in Le Pont d'Arc: General Trends and Swimming Opportunities

Le Pont d'Arc is a famous natural landmark located near the village of Vallon-Pont-d'Arc, in the Ardèche region of southern France. It is a stunning stone arch that spans the Ardèche River, creating a picturesque spot for outdoor activities. The river here is known for its crystal-clear water and is popular for canoeing, kayaking, and swimming, particularly in the warmer months. The water temperature in the Ardèche River varies with the seasons. During the summer (June to August), the water temperature typically reaches between 22°C and 24°C (72°F - 75°F), making it ideal for swimming. In the cooler months, from November to March, the water temperature drops significantly, often below 10°C (50°F), making swimming less appealing.

Swimmers often enjoy the area around Le Pont d'Arc, where the water is calm and clear, providing a refreshing swimming experience. The river's natural beauty and the surrounding cliffs and caves add to the allure, making it a popular destination for both locals and tourists. While the water is generally safe for swimming, it is important to note that some sections of the Ardèche River near Le Pont d'Arc can be fast-flowing, especially after heavy rains, so caution is advised when swimming in these areas.

What is the water temperature in Le Pont d'Arc during the summer months?

The average water temperature in Le Pont d'Arc during the summer months is typically between 71°F to 75°F (21°C to 24°C), and it can reach up to 84°F (29°C) at its warmest. However, in some years, the temperature may exceed this range.

What is the water temperature in Le Pont d'Arc in May?

The average water temperature in Le Pont d'Arc in May ranges from 55°F to 66°F (13°C to 19°C).

What is the water temperature in Le Pont d'Arc in September?

The average water temperature in Le Pont d'Arc in September is typically between 61°F to 75°F (16°C to 24°C).

Is it possible to swim in the Ardèche River in Le Pont d'Arc, and what are the available options for doing so?

Yes, it is possible to swim in the Ardèche River in Le Pont d'Arc. Available options include supervised bathing areas, canoeing expeditions, and wild swimming areas.
